Effect of 2-thiouracil on flower initiation in rice and wheat plants grown under aseptic conditions

抄録

In order to investigate biochemical changes involved in flowering, number of attempts on modifying flower initiation by application of nucleic acid base-analogues, i.e., 8-azaguanine and thiouracil, have been conducted. 1,2,3,7,8,9,10,11) In the case of rice plants, one of the most thermo-sensitive varieties, Z-thiouracil inhibited flower initiation under aseptic conditions.3) By using the aseptic culture methods, the present experiment was conducted to examine the effect of 2-thiouracil and its detecting in ribonucleic acid from treated rice plants. In a few experiments, the reversal of the effect of 2-thiouracil by uracil or its metabolic precursor erotic acid was also examined.
